Output 03f91fc394749931f8f7459a595ff80a916fefe248041278a15c16096063997a:1

value
72559
script pubkey
OP_0 OP_PUSHBYTES_20 c34c820adc46e3da8e517d239f2b26e1dc815e05
address
bc1qcdxgyzkugm3a4rj3053e72exu8wgzhs9fgg4m6
transaction
03f91fc394749931f8f7459a595ff80a916fefe248041278a15c16096063997a
spent
true